Situated within the southeastern corner of Central Park near 59th Street and Fifth Avenue, Gapstow Bridge is one of the most recognizable and easily accessible wedding locations in New York City. With sweeping views of the Pond, the skyline, and nearby landmarks like The Plaza Hotel, Gapstow Bridge offers a classic New York setting that feels both intimate and iconic at the same time..

Its stone construction and gently curved design create a natural focal point for ceremonies and photography, making it especially popular for couples who want a true NYC backdrop without venturing deep into the park.

Gapstow Bridge stands out for its combination of accessibility and visual impact. Unlike more remote areas of Central Park, this location is just steps from major entrances, making it easy for guests, photographers, and vendors to coordinate without long walks or complicated logistics.


Gapstow Bridge Central Park Wedding | NYC Wedding Officiant

From the bridge, you’ll find:

  • Clear skyline views that instantly signal “New York”
  • Reflections on the Pond that enhance wedding photos
  • Seasonal scenery — from vibrant fall foliage to snow-covered winter landscapes

For elopements and small ceremonies, Gapstow Bridge delivers a polished look without requiring extensive setup or décor.

Because Gapstow Bridge is a public and high-traffic location, ceremonies here are typically short, simple, and well-timed. Early mornings and weekdays offer the best chance for a quieter experience, while sunset provides some of the most dramatic lighting for photos.

Couples should be aware:

  • Permits may be required depending on group size
  • Space on the bridge is limited
  • Foot traffic can be heavy, especially during peak tourist seasons

That said, with proper timing and coordination, it’s absolutely possible to have a smooth and meaningful ceremony here.

CENTRAL PARK WEDDING PERMIT INFORMATION:


A Central park wedding ceremony permit is required for weddings in certain Central Park locations regardless of how large the size your party or whenever your party exceeds 20 people.

To apply for a Central Park Wedding Permit, please click here. It generally takes about 1 month to process your Central Park Wedding Permit.

Applicants can apply online, download the form and mail it in or physically go to the permit office and apply. Applicant should not fax over the permit application.

The processing fee is $25.00. Permit payment can consist of money orders and checks and should be sent through the mail. Credit card & Debit cards are used for online applications.

PARK RESTRICTIONS:

No Balloons – they tend to get caught up in trees and they are not good for the environment.

No Set-Up – Allowance can be made for two small folding chairs and folding card table. The public must be able to have access to the park

No vehicles are permitted on park land. Petty cabs are allowed to drop off at Cherry Hill location only.

No amplified sound is permitted. Amplified sound only allowed at the Band shell; they are allowed a small radio.

No staking in the ground – costs money to fix divets in the ground

No Alcohol is allowed in any New York City Park.

Clean up your venue when the ceremony has concluded. Your location should be in the same condition before the ceremony commenced.
